
The 2026 Presidents Cup rosters are officially locked in, and the captain’s picks are definitely going to spark some serious conversations among golf fans. United States captain Brandt Snedeker and International captain Geoff Ogilvy have unveiled their final selections, completing two squads packed with a mix of seasoned veterans and some fresh, hungry talent ready to battle it out. Snedeker’s Bold US Selections Highlight Youth and Proven Talent
For the United States team, Brandt Snedeker went with a lineup that balances experience with a significant nod to future stars. His captain’s picks are Justin Thomas, Xander Schauffele, Patrick Cantlay, Jackson Koivun, Jacob Bridgeman, and Chris Gotterup. You have to love seeing Thomas, Schauffele, and Cantlay back in the mix. These guys have been there, they have felt the pressure of the Presidents Cup before, and their veteran presence is absolutely crucial for team leadership. But man, the name that really jumps out is Jackson Koivun. This kid is just 21 years old and already making huge waves. Winning the 3M Open in July, in only his third professional start, tells you everything you need to know about his potential. Snedeker is making a statement, bringing in a fearless rookie who has already proven he can perform under pressure. These picks join the automatic qualifiers Scottie Scheffler, Cameron Young, Wyndham Clark, Russell Henley, Sam Burns, and Collin Morikawa to form a seriously stacked US squad.
International Side Brings Experience and Undeniable Grit
Over on the International side, Geoff Ogilvy’s captain’s picks are Sungjae Im, Christiaan Bezuidenhout, Corey Conners, Nico Echavarria, Ryo Hisatsune, and Nick Taylor. Ogilvy clearly went for players who were right on the cusp of qualifying automatically, showing faith in guys like Conners, Echavarria, Im, and Hisatsune, who just narrowly missed out. That’s a smart move, giving a shot to players who have been performing at a high level all season. But keep an eye on Christiaan Bezuidenhout. This guy has made two Presidents Cup appearances in the past, and he owns a seriously impressive 3-1-1 record in the competition. That kind of clutch performance and proven ability to deliver when the stakes are highest? That is an invaluable asset for the International team. These captain’s picks are joining their automatic qualifiers: Si Woo Kim, Adam Scott, Hideki Matsuyama, Ryan Fox, Tom Kim, and Min Woo Lee.
This epic showdown kicks off on September 22nd at Medinah Country Club in Illinois. With these finalized rosters, both captains have laid their cards on the table.
